#480e9a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#480e9a is composed of 28.2% red, 5.5% green and 60.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.2% cyan, 90.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 39.6% black. It has a hue angle of 264.9 degrees, a saturation of 83.3% and a lightness of 32.9%. #480e9a color hex could be obtained by blending #901cff with #000035.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

Shades and Tints of #480e9a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05010a is the darkest color, while #faf7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#480e9a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#534f59 is the less saturated color, while #4601a7 is the most saturated one.
